Voyage of Horror - Director's Cut (HPL2)
------------------------------------------

Last year's modding team reformed - under the name Anathema Syndicate - and went all out this year in terms of group projects. John Ekvall, one of our founding members, replaced me in the director's chair for the sake of a revisit. The project that inadvertently started the group - Voyage of Horror - was getting a remaster with the full workforce of our Syndicate. Writing, dialogue, and world re-building was once again led by myself, while the rest of our team tackled individual locations, additional scripts, and our "bandmaster" Hannes Skoglund returned to compose more tracks. The production closed with May, the result was scoring one of the top places on the Amnesia steam workshop "Most Popular" thus far.

Lifeless - Descent into Abandon (HPL2)
-----------------------------------------

Following Voyage's success, co-founders Justin Xerri, José Thous and myself decided to tackle a more personal theme in our next piece. Since multiple members of the team suffered personal losses this year, trauma and a closely connected motif - addiction - was chosen to serve as the foundation. In line with my more technical/professional activities I spent months building and writing the world of Lifeless, many of it stemming from my own personal struggles and victories against such habits. The protagonist faces a personal journey from our culminated experience, a fight against his own mind and for the remainder of his sanity. Both the visual and psychological aspects of the project were praised by many comments and reviews since our mid-December release, and we're looking at a similar level of popularity in the near future as our aforementioned project. Anathema Syndicate is definitely keen on taking more challenges next year!

MyTurnTable - Unity mobile application
----------------------------------------

Similarly in December, under the banner of "Grapes and Grapes", the beta of our collaboration project came out in the form of MyTurnTable - a retro vinyl style mobile application. It also marks my long-planned return to the Unity engine where I completed my thesis project. The Linux webserver and connected Wordpress page is in my father's care, while I mostly focused on the technicalities in C# myself. The app is aimed at a different audience than my usual works, and meant more for commercial use - the success of which is still ahead of us.
